low carbon steel welding electrode AWS E6013 

For welding low carbon steel light-gauge sheet structures

Easy striking and restriking,low spatter,low smoke,holds an unusually stable arc,great for fast welds

1, welding electrodes: AWS E6013

2, Available size: 2.5*300/350mm/3.2*350mm/4.0*400mm

3, chemical composition: C <=0.12, Mn 0.30--0.60, Si <=0.35, S <=0.035, P <=0.040

4, It is suitable for all position welding of steel sheets and irregular joints even under unfavorable conditions.

5, has excellent welding technological performances

6, The arc is stable and the spatter loss is negligible

7, The slag is fluid and when hardened it is compact and easy to remove

8, It is better for welding structures of steel sheets. Vehicles, buildings, machinery-manufacture, vessels and various structures of low carbon steel

9, Packing in 1kgs/box, 20boxes per carton. 5kgs/box, 4boxes per carton .  NW: 20KG

10. Certificates: ISO9001 and CCS (China Classification Society).

Q: H0Cr20Ni10Ti H08Cr19Ni10Ti (ER321) to replace the standard YB/T5092-2005? Only H08Cr19Ni10Ti (ER321), it is not written to replace the one ah, whether there is a substitute for national notice? For the pressure vessel, to use H0Cr20Ni10Ti but the seller said this is a veteran, H08Cr19Ni10Ti (ER321) is a new grade, but can not find alternative basis?
The term "H0Cr20Ni10Ti" does not exist in standard books. It is only a term used by some manufacturers. The term "ER321" is used only in the American Standard for welding materials. There are two standards for stainless steel solid wire in our country now. One is the standard GB/T17854-1999 for submerged arc welding wire, and the other is the newly updated standard of Metallurgical Department of YB/T5092-2005. Another precursor to this standard was YB/T5092-1996. The standard for metallurgy is now in general use, so H08Cr19Ni10Ti is the most standard name. I estimate that your drawings are required to use H0Cr20Ni10Ti, but the supplier cannot provide the same material certificate. These two kinds of welding wire are in fact of the same material, no difference. If you want to meet the requirements of Party A, you must communicate with the manufacturer. There is no other way!
